Income & Housing

Median Household Income $74,508
Per Capita Income $35,045
Poverty Rate 5.4%
Median Home Value $205,200
Median Gross Rent $811/mo
Owner Occupied 74.1%
Renter Occupied 25.9%

Demographics & Education

Total Population 6,492
Median Age 42.3 yrs
Bachelor's or Higher 23.0%
